G. W. Anders cards are filed under the name G. W. Andrews,

G. W. Andrews, Private, Company K, 44th Mississippi Infantry, transferred to Sharpshoters June 25, 1862 [I have not been able to locate this file]

........

William Kenor Harvey, age 18, Private, Co. K, 44th Mississippi, died of disease February 1, 1862 at Columbus, Kentucky,

........

George W. Hazelwood, age 17, Co. K, 44th Mississippi, sick in hospital April 15, 1862, died of disease August/November 1/October 30, 1862 at Pikeville, Tennessee, mother Nancy Hazelwood filed claim for his effects

..........

John D. Rawlinson, age 30, died of disease February 8/9, 1862 at Columbus, Kentucky

.........

Unable to locate a John Robinson

M269: Compiled Service Records of Confederate Soldiers Who Served in Organizations from the State of Mississippi
